Cosa sono le toppe ricamate con il ferro da stiro?
Risposta:
Iron on embroidered patches are decorative fabric patches with a heat-activated adhesive layer on the back. They allow users to attach logos, symbols, or designs to clothing and accessories by applying heat with an iron or heat press.
Compared with traditional sew-on patches, iron on embroidered patches provide a faster application method while maintaining a professional embroidered appearance.

How to Make Iron On Embroidered Patches Step by Step?
Risposta:
Making iron on embroidered patches involves several professional manufacturing steps, including design preparation, embroidery, adhesive application, and finishing. Each step affects the final quality, durability, and appearance of the patch.
Step 1: Prepare the Embroidery Design
The first step is converting the customer’s logo or artwork into an embroidery-ready digital file.
Professional designers analyze:
- Complessità del progetto
- Direzione del punto
- Colori del filo
- Requisiti di frontiera
- Size limitations
Unlike printed graphics, embroidery uses threads to recreate the design. Therefore, some small details may need adjustment to ensure clear and attractive results.
A professional embroidered patch supplier usually provides digitization support to optimize artwork before production.

Step 2: Select Suitable Patch Materials
Risposta:
Material selection determines the durability and appearance of iron on embroidered patches.
Tra i materiali più comuni figurano:
Tessuto di base
Tra le opzioni più popolari figurano:
- Tessuto Twill
- Tessuto in feltro
- Tessuto in poliestere
- Tessuto di cotone
Twill is commonly used because it provides a smooth surface and strong support for embroidery.
Filo da ricamo
Thread selection affects color, shine, and durability. Common thread options include:
- Polyester thread for strength
- Rayon thread for a glossy appearance
- Metallic thread for decorative effects
Adesivo termoattivabile
The back layer is usually made from a special adhesive film that melts under heat and bonds with fabric surfaces.
Step 3: Embroider the Patch Design
Risposta:
The embroidery process uses computerized machines to stitch the design onto the patch material according to the digital embroidery file.
During production, machines control:
- Densità dei punti
- Posizionamento del filo
- Cambiamenti di colore
- Border stitching
The embroidery process creates the raised texture that makes patches visually attractive.
For bulk orders, professional manufacturers use advanced embroidery equipment to ensure every patch maintains the same quality and appearance.
Step 4: Add the Iron-On Adhesive Backing
Risposta:
After embroidery is completed, manufacturers apply a heat-activated adhesive layer to the back of the patch.
This backing allows customers to attach the patch using heat.
The adhesive process includes:
- Preparing adhesive material
- Applying it evenly to the patch back
- Using heat and pressure to secure the layer
- Checking bonding quality
A high-quality adhesive backing should provide:
- Forte attaccamento
- Facile applicazione
- Long-lasting performance
Step 5: Cut the Patch Into the Final Shape
Risposta:
After adhesive application, patches are cut into their final shapes according to customer requirements.
Common cutting methods include:
Taglio laser
- Creates precise edges
- Suitable for complex shapes
- Provides clean finishing
Fustellatura
- Efficient for large production quantities
- Creates consistent shapes
Custom shapes may include:
- Loghi del marchio
- Lettere
- Animali
- Simboli
- Modelli unici
Step 6: Quality Inspection and Packaging
Risposta:
The final production stage involves checking every patch to ensure it meets quality standards.
I produttori ispezionano:
- Precisione del ricamo
- Qualità del filo
- Finitura dei bordi
- Resistenza dell'adesivo
- Consistenza del colore
For wholesale buyers, quality control is especially important because large orders require consistent results across thousands of pieces.

What Is the Difference Between Iron On and Sew On Embroidered Patches?
Risposta:
Iron on patches use heat-activated adhesive backing, while sew-on patches require stitching. The best choice depends on product usage, durability requirements, and production methods.
| Caratteristica | Iron On Embroidered Patches | Toppe ricamate da cucire |
|---|---|---|
| Applicazione | Pressa o ferro da stiro | È necessario cucire |
| Velocità di installazione | Più veloce | Più lento |
| Durata | Buono | Eccellente |
| Ideale per | Fashion and casual products | Heavy-duty products |
| Praticità di produzione | Alto | Medio |
Many brands choose iron-on patches for retail products because they simplify application and reduce production steps.

Frequently Asked Questions About How to Make Iron On Embroidered Patches
1. What materials are used to make iron on embroidered patches?
Iron on embroidered patches usually include a fabric base, embroidery thread, and heat-activated adhesive backing.
2. Can any logo be made into an iron on embroidered patch?
Most logos can be converted into patches, but complex details may require design adjustments for embroidery production.
3. How long do iron on embroidered patches last?
High-quality patches can last for years when properly attached and maintained.
4. Can iron on patches be washed?
Yes, but following proper washing instructions helps maintain adhesive strength and embroidery quality.
5. What is the best backing for custom embroidered patches?
Heat-activated adhesive backing is ideal for quick application, while sew-on backing provides maximum durability.
